Getting Started

First install the package via PyPi.

pip install Apex-agents-py

Then define your agent, give it the tools it needs and run it!

from Apex import CodeAgent, DuckDuckGoSearchTool, HfApiModel

agent = CodeAgent(tools=[DuckDuckGoSearchTool()], model=HfApiModel())

agent.run("Tell me Solana and Bitcoin price in March 2025")
